Implementing Multi-Factor Authentication

One of the most effective cybersecurity solutions is implementing multi-factor authentication (MFA). MFA adds an extra layer of security by requiring users to provide two or more verification factors to gain access to a system. This significantly reduces the risk of unauthorized access, even if login credentials are compromised.

Businesses should encourage employees to use MFA for all systems and accounts, especially those containing sensitive information. By doing so, companies can protect themselves from potential breaches and data theft during the busy holiday season.

Conducting Regular Security Audits

Regular security audits are vital for identifying vulnerabilities and ensuring that cybersecurity measures are up-to-date. These audits involve evaluating the current security infrastructure, identifying potential weaknesses, and implementing necessary improvements.

Training Employees in Cybersecurity Best Practices

Employees play a critical role in maintaining cybersecurity. Providing comprehensive training on cybersecurity best practices can help prevent human errors that often lead to breaches. Training should cover topics such as recognizing phishing emails, using strong passwords, and securing personal devices used for work.

Regular workshops and updates can keep employees informed about the latest cyber threats and how to mitigate them effectively. An informed workforce is a strong line of defense against cyberattacks.

Investing in Advanced Threat Detection Systems

Advanced threat detection systems are essential for identifying and responding to potential threats in real-time. These systems use art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ms to analyze network traffic and detect anomalies that may indicate malicious activities.

Strengthening Network Security with Firewalls

A strong firewall is a fundamental component of effective network security. Firewalls act as barriers between internal networks and external threats, blocking unauthorized access and monitoring incoming and outgoing traffic.

Businesses should ensure their firewall systems are robust and regularly updated to protect against the latest cyber threats. A well-configured firewall can prevent many types of cyberattacks from reaching internal systems.

Ensuring Data Encryption

Data encryption is critical for protecting sensitive information from unauthorized access. By encrypting data both at rest and in transit, businesses can ensure that even if data is intercepted, it remains unreadable to unauthorized parties.
